SAN BERNARDINO - Three defendants in the 'Devils Professor' drug-trafficking case - including alleged methamphetamine supplier Jeremy Disney - pleaded not guilty to the charges Friday. Holly Robinson, of Highland, Hans Preszler and Disney, both of San Bernardino, appeared before Judge Kenneth Barr, who entered the pleas and denied all allegations on behalf of the defendants, during their arraignment in San Bernardino Superior Court.Prosecutors say the three defendants were part of a trafficking ring operated by Cal State professor Steve Kinzey, who authorities say is also president of the San Bernardino Mountains Chapter of the Devils Diciples motorcycle club.Kinzey also appeared in court Friday for a status hearing.
